Default EM1 fuel and temp gauges don't work

The fuel and temp gauges in my EM1 don't work for some reason. The fuel stays at fuel ALL the time and my temp gauge stays on hot all the time except when I turn off the car, the temp gauge drops all the way down. I checked all the fuses and everything and can't figure out the problem. Would a new fuel/temp gauge fix my problem? It's like $50 from Honda. Would be cheaper instead of buying the whole cluster.

Default Re: EM1 fuel and temp gauges don't work

Sounds like there's a short in the wires running from the cluster to the ECT sending unit and the fuel sending unit. Use your multimeter to test those two wires for a short.
